Governor nixes deal, threatens state takeover of PG&E

Despite "clear guidance" from his office, Gov. Gavin Newsom argued PG&E has "yet to make a single modification" to its plan to remedy "its many deficiencies," according to court documents.

Gov. Gavin Newsom has threatened a state takeover of the Pacific Gas & Electric Co. after the utility submitted a new restructuring plan he maintains is not in the public interest.

PG&E's deal with a group of bondholders clears a major hurdle in its bankruptcy by eliminating the only competing reorganization plan, but Newsom again urged the court to hold off on approving PG&E's proposal for it to emerge from bankruptcy....
